Swedish women's national team: Training in Cham starts soon!

The Eizmoos sports facility in Cham has become the contact point for the Swedish women's national team. The team will begin preparations for the UEFA Women's Euro 2025 on June 29, 2025, and SC Cham, the municipality of Cham and the OYM are looking forward to the sporting challenge. Christina Lindgren from SC Cham emphasizes: “We are proud to host a team that is one of the best in the world,” as on Regional football reported.

Under the leadership of coach Peter Gerhardsson, the team, known by the nickname “Blågult” (The Blue and Yellow), will set up their official base camp at the top sports center OYM. Here the team is preparing for the upcoming games, with training times set from June 29th to July 10th. Most of the units are not public, but a special highlight will be the public training on Monday, June 30, 2025, from 11:30 a.m. to 1:00 p.m., where a small fan zone will also be set up in Bistro1910.

Public training and fan zone

The public training offers fans and interested parties the opportunity to take part in the players' preparations up close. To ensure a smooth visit, spectators should arrive early and use public transport if possible. There are no parking spaces around the Eizmoos stadium, but the Papieri and Neudorf car parks and other options in the center of Cham are available. The stadium can be reached on foot from the town center in about 20-25 minutes. There is also a direct bus connection to the Cham, Eizmoos stop, bus line 642.

Team background and achievements

The Swedish women's national football team is not only very successful regionally, but also has a great reputation internationally. The team is from Swedish Football Association (Svenska Fotbollförbundet) controls and can already look back on an impressive history. They are considered one of the best teams in the world, with a title as European champions in 1984 and a runner-up in the World Cup in 2003. With players like captain Caroline Seger, who has already won 233 caps, Sweden will certainly be a hot candidate at Euro 2025.

The team has established itself among the world's best for years, is regularly represented at the Olympic Games and World Championships and has collected a large number of medals, including silver medals at the 2016 and 2020 Olympic Games. The Swedes are currently in 3rd place in the FIFA world rankings, with a high of 2nd place in August 2021.
